Transaction 3315329dd4ca8ec720f68f76caf12a9acda68d038bdf553049291be43f180902
1 Input
1 Output
-
3315329dd4ca8ec720f68f76caf12a9acda68d038bdf553049291be43f180902:0
- value
- 109900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 401aace48f8df1f16e8f2833f8a054c3151120cb OP_EQUAL
- address
- 37Xy8FtmShdeSHqBtLLxjA2bpvuK7FXToZ